Answer : 2. "5 June"
Explanation :

1. World Environment Day is celebrated every year on 5 June.

2. Its objective is to make mankind aware of the environment.

3. First held in 1973, it has been a platform to raise awareness on environmental issues such as marine pollution, overpopulation, global warming, sustainable development and wildlife crime. World Environment Day is a global platform for public outreach, with participation from over 143 countries annually.

Answer : 2. "Mannar"
Explanation :

1. Palk Strait is a strait between the Indian state of Tamil Nadu and the Mannar district of the Northern Province of Sri Lanka.

2. This strait connects the Bay of Bengal to the Palk Bay in the north-east and then to the Gulf of Mannar in the south-west.

Answer : 1. "Leonardo-da-Vinci "
Explanation :

1. The "Last Supper" was painted by Leonardo da Vinci between 1494 and 1498 in the city of Milan, Italy, depicting the last "supper" between Jesus and his followers.

2. This is a fresco and is approximately 15 feet x 29 feet in size.

  3. The painting still hangs on the wall of the Convent of Maria delle Grazie in Milan.
